How Much Yarn Do I Need To Arm Knit A Blanket? The amount you need to arm knit a blanket is 2.2lbs (1kg) for a Baby Blanket to 15lbs (7kgs) for an Extra Large Blanket. Here’s the amount for 5 arm knit blankets. Baby Blanket ~ 30″x30″ (76 x 76cm) 2.2lbs (1 kg) ligh...
